Внешняя память ОМ
Объекты файловой системы хранятся на внешней памяти ОМ. Внешняя память ОМ состоит из дисковой и массовой памяти.
Дисковая память состоит из совокупности несъемных дисков, управляемых контроллерами (или дисковыми серверами), которые подключены к основной машине через каналы (пропускная способность 10 Мгб/сек).
Память на дисках представляет собой последовательность блоков по 512 64-х разрядных слов. Контроллер дисковой памяти (или дисковый сервер) реализует команды обмена между оперативной памятью основной машины и блоками диска. Одной операцией обмена (записи или чтения) можно задать обмен с совокупностью смежных блоков на диске.
Наблюдается существенный дисбаланс в соотношении скорости процессора основной машины и темпом обмена с дисками.
Для того, чтобы сбалансировать процессор с внешней памятью, используется массовая интегральная память емкостью до 256 Мгб, темпом обмена 0,64 мксек/слово, которая подключена через каналы с пропускной способностью 200 Мгб/сек.
Таким образом, внешняя память ОМ является двухуровневой: первичная внешняя паямть - интегральная массовая память и вторичная - дисковая память.
Обычный режим работы файловой системы - обработка активных файлов в массовой памяти, предварительно переписанных в нее из дисковой памяти. Однако существует возможность работы с файлами и на дисковой памяти, например, для файлов с последовательной организацией.
Принципиальной особенностью массовой памяти является наличие процессора массовой памяти. Процессор массовой памяти под управлением программ, реализующих тот или иной метод доступа к данным в массовой памяти, осуществляет генерацию адресов ячеек массовой памяти, участвующих в процессе обмена данными с оперативной памятью ОМ. Возможна, например, организация обмена только с ячейками, содержащими элементы некоторых строк, столбцов, диагоналей, клеток расположенных в массовой памяти матриц данных.
Использование процессора массовой памяти повышает суммарную эффективность системы, потому что освобождает процессор ОМ от рутинной работы и уменьшает время и число обменов с внешней памятью, поскольку поток данных между ОМ и массовой памятью будет содержать только полезную информацию.